About AT&T

AT&T provides telecommunications services, including wireless communications, broadband internet, and digital television, primarily in the United States. Its 5G network offers faster data speeds and more reliable connections, although availability can vary. The company caters to both individual consumers and businesses, offering various subscription plans that include options for unlimited data and bundled services that combine internet, TV, and phone. AT&T generates revenue mainly through subscription fees, device sales, and its streaming service, DIRECTV STREAM, which adds to its diverse offerings. In a competitive market, AT&T distinguishes itself with its extensive service range and strong brand presence.
